Power Feedthroughs are used to transmit high voltage or high current into vacuum systems and are widely used in Aerospace, Nanotechnology, Communication, and Semiconductor industries.

Operating Ranges

Baseplate style operating temperature: −20 °C to 150 °C.

Type Voltage / Current Conductor # of Pins Operating Temp. Notes
Medium Voltage 10 kV / 25 A BeCu 1–8 −100 °C to 450 °C
Bake Temp:
CF flange up to 450 °C
KF flange up to 150 °C
High Voltage 100 kV / 180 A BeCu 1–4 −100 °C to 450 °C
High Current 12 kV / 600 A Cu, Ni, SS 1–10 −100 °C to 450 °C
Water Cooled 8 kV / 1,000 A Cu 1–4 −100 °C to 450 °C For continuous high current duty

Actual ratings depend on flange size, pin count, creepage/clearance, and environment.

High Current Conductor Selection
Conductor Current Capacity Corrosion Resistance
Copper (Cu) High Low
Stainless Steel (SS) Low Medium
Nickel (Ni) Medium High

Select based on required current, base pressure, and working gas.

Notes & Mounting Options

The key selection criteria are maximum operating voltage, maximum current per conductor, base pressure, and working environment (gas type and pressure). Standard high-power and high-voltage models in multiple ratings and flange styles are in stock.

Mounting options: Weldable, KF, CF, and Baseplate. Baseplate versions are commonly used in vacuum furnaces and coating applications. NPT configurations are available via adapters.
